Quite simply a reaction to a cold world...just make yourself colder on the inside. And don't dare show any emotion ("You shouldn't see me crying"), or it might seem like your fight against the world is failing.
An awesome song from an album chock full of 'em. Any Husker Du fun who dislikes Warehouse for being too "clean" sounding is probably hearing it on the CD, with its 1987-standard piss-poor mastering. Until Warner Bros. has the good sense to remaster it, get yourself a record player and find the double-vinyl set. It sure changed my opinion of Warehouse...this album rocks harder than the much-beloved "Flip Your Wig."
